Bugsnax is one of the first confirmed PS5 PlayStation Plus titles, will headline November’s offerings

PlayStation Plus is moving into the new generation: although it won’t be leaving the PS4 behind.

Just today Sony confirmed that in addition to Destruction All-Stars, Bugsnax will be joining the PS+ lineup. Although, while the former is due in February of 2021, the latter is coming at launch in November. There is a catch with Bugsnax though: it’s PS5-only.

Even though Bugsnax is launching on PC and PS4 in addition to Sony’s new console, it’s a PS5 Plus exclusive. That offer is good from November 12 through January 4, 2021. Developer Young Horses says that “anyone who buys Bugsnax for the PS4 will be able to upgrade to the PS5 version for free. Those who purchase the PS5 version will also own the PS4 version. However, players who redeem Bugsnax on the PS5 through their PlayStation Plus subscription will not be entitled to the PS4 version.” Got it? It’s no Smart Delivery, that’s for sure.

“All PS4/PS5 owners” will be able to redeem Middle-earth: Shadow of War and Hollow Knight: Voidheart Edition. Those will be on offer from November 3 to November 30.
